Women's soccer squeaks past CSU-Pueblo in OT

Box Score

PUEBLO, Colo. - Metro State earned a 2-1 overtime victory on Friday night at Colorado State-Pueblo when Michael' Ann Karas (Arvada, Colo./Faith Christian H.S.) scored 4:20 into overtime.  The Roadrunners improved to 11-2-1 overall and 7-2-1 in the Rocky Mountain Athletic Conference, while CSUP fell to 5-8-1 and 2-6-1.

Karas took a pass from Abby Rolph (Golden, Colo./Golden H.S.) and fired a shot past CSUP goalkeeper Savannah Thompson, who got a hand on the ball.

The Roadrunners initially took a 1-0 lead just 15:28 into the game when Karisa Price (Gilbert, Ariz./Highland H.S.) scored on a cross from Allyn Parrino (Brockport, N.Y./Brockport H.S.).

The ThunderWolves tied the game just over a minute into the second half on a goal by Alicia Irwin, who bent a shot in over Metro State goalkeeper Danielle Quigley (Arvada, Colo./Arvada West H.S.).  Quigley ended up with four saves.

Metro State outshot the ThunderWolves 19-13 in the game.

Metro State will travel to No. 21 Fort Lewis on Sunday.
